#6CC35E Hex color

#6CC35E

The hexadecimal color code #6CC35E corresponds to the code RGB( 108, 195, 94 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,42 level), green (at 0,76 level) and blue (at 0,37 level). Its brightness is 56% and its saturation is 45%. It is composed of red at 27%, green at 49% and blue at 23%.
